Definition of Caucus
Caucus
Cau·cus


Definition/Meaning
(noun)
A meeting of members of a political party or group to select candidates.

e.g. The Democratic caucus will meet tonight to discuss the upcoming election.

(verb)
to meet or hold a legislative caucus;

e.g. The members briefly caucused this morning.
